As the research and analysis division of the Economist Group, The Economist Intelligence Unit (EIU) helps businesses and organisations prepare for opportunity, empowering them to act with confidence when making strategic decisions. The EIU is the global standard in providing quality, actionable intelligence to the public and private sector, assessing issues that impact the marketplace for over 200 countries.
